CS 225 (Data Structures and Software Principles) @ UIUC -- Historical Lab Code Library

Since a historical set of 2002-era CS225 lectures was made available on archive.org by Jason Zych in 2021, we think that the companion C++ lab code that went along with the Spring 2005 counterpart to those lectures should be made freely available too.

To clone the repository, run the following bash terminal command:

$ git clone https://github.com/maxieds/CS225UIUCHistoricalLabCodeLibrary\..git
